Now we have grown again to now offering feature walls. This is where we and you get to have FUN. Using tongue and groove lumber we create a wall overlay of almost any size that is very easy to install. This installation is very easy even for someone who has not done much wood working before.
Laying it out on the ground to look at the designs that you can see when the different pieces are laid out together. Tongue and groove wood is quite easy to work with because it holds together and chunks can be moved around so different designs can be explored.
Sometimes you have to adjust the bottom layer so it is level. Starting can be challenging with the varying types of base bords there is. It is best to keep it level at the very bottom. It is nice to get up a few layers so you can get off your hands and knees.
When applying the nails be sure you check level at every layer.
Getting close to finish. Just be sure the boards are cut correctly.

This Western Red Cedar is tongue and groove 1x8 used in home building in 1940 when this house was built. The paneling was what was showing when the wall was taken down to do some remodeling.
Because this is 1x8 and beetle eaten, I decided to burn a single line in the middle or around the middle to give it enough burn and still leave enough space for the beetle eaten areas to be enjoyed
We approaching plugins and light switches you need to power off the circuits and be sure you leave enough room for the boxes to fit in.
Some times around the switch boxes the piece pops out and you have to make adjustments.
When finishing the top layer sometimes it is possible to slip the board up into the gap left when removing the old boards. It makes the finish look a lot better. As you can see here we have not quite finished with the remolding.
